Dereplication of depsides from the lichen Pseudevernia furfuracea by centrifugal partition chromatography combined to 13C nuclear magnetic resonance pattern recognition.

Analytica Chimica Acta(2014)

Cited 25|Views16
No score
Abstract
•The major depsides of a lichen extract were directly identified within mixtures.•The initial extract was rapidly fractionated by CPC in the pH-zone refining mode.•Hierarchical clustering of 13C NMR signals resulted in the identification of depside molecular skeletons.•13C chemical shift clusters were assigned to structures using a 13C NMR database.•Six depsides were unambiguously identified by this approach.
